The Vedruna Family has its origin in Joaquina de Vedruna, a believing woman, moved by the desire to embrace all the needs of the people and to give glory to God.
We are committed to proclaiming, caring for and defending life
“to work for the glory of God and the good of our neighbor, embracing all the needs of the people.”

Educating
We train people committed to the common good, through different educational platforms.

Healing
We promote integral health care, with closeness, respect and a sense of community.

Unlock
We are present on the peripheries, accompanying with compassion those who need it most.
